Understanding the Thoroughbred Horse Adoption Process

Adopting a thoroughbred horse is a rewarding experience that requires careful consideration and understanding of the adoption process. In Newcastle, South Africa, the process typically involves several steps. First, potential adopters need to research and identify reputable rescue organizations or shelters that specialize in thoroughbred horse adoption. These organizations often have specific criteria and requirements for potential adopters, such as experience in horse care and a suitable environment for the horse.

Once a potential adopter has identified a suitable organization, they will need to complete an adoption application and undergo a screening process. This may include interviews, reference checks, and even home visits to ensure the horse will be going to a loving and suitable environment. If the adopter meets all the requirements and is approved, they will then go through a matching process to find the perfect horse that suits their needs, experience, and abilities.

Key Considerations for Potential Thoroughbred Horse Adopters in Newcastle, South Africa

Before embarking on the journey of thoroughbred horse adoption in Newcastle, potential adopters should carefully consider a few key factors. Firstly, it is essential to evaluate one’s level of experience and confidence as a horse owner or rider. Thoroughbreds, while intelligent and athletic, can sometimes be spirited and require an experienced handler.

Financial considerations are also crucial. Adopters should ensure they have the resources to provide for the horse’s needs, including feed, veterinary care, farrier services, and appropriate shelter. It is important to have a realistic understanding of the costs associated with horse ownership and be prepared to meet them.

Another vital consideration is the available space and facilities. Thoroughbreds, as active and energetic horses, require ample room to roam and exercise. Prospective adopters should assess their property to ensure it can accommodate the needs of a thoroughbred horse, such as suitable pasture and secure fencing.

Finding the Perfect Match: Matching Thoroughbred Horses with Suitable Adopters

The process of finding the perfect match between a thoroughbred horse and a potential adopter is crucial in ensuring a successful adoption. Reputable rescue organizations and shelters strive to make quality matches by considering various factors, including the adopter’s experience level, riding discipline preferences, and the temperament and health of the horse.

Adopters should be prepared to work closely with the organization or shelter to find their ideal horse. This may involve multiple visits, meeting different horses, observing their behavior, and even undertaking trial periods to assess compatibility. Patience and open communication are key during this process to ensure the best possible match is made.

Ensuring the Welfare and Well-being of Adopted Thoroughbred Horses in Newcastle, South Africa

Ensuring the ongoing welfare and well-being of adopted thoroughbred horses is a shared responsibility between the adopter and the rescue organization or shelter. Adopters should commit to providing proper nutrition, regular veterinary care, farrier services, and a safe and comfortable living environment for their adopted horse.

Regular exercise and mental stimulation are also crucial for the well-being of a thoroughbred. Adopters should engage in regular training sessions, provide opportunities for turnout and socialization, and ensure the horse’s mental and physical needs are met. Additionally, maintaining open communication with the rescue organization or shelter can provide ongoing support and guidance to address any concerns or challenges that may arise.
